Handover — fleet fuel report (Darrow → you)

Report runs Mondays 06:00 from the Pellan telematics feed. Watch for stale odometer rows; the job drops anything older than 14 days. Output goes to the ops share, CSV only. Don't change the aggregation window without asking dispatch. Job configuration values follow below.

deployment values, yadug-bawif:
[framir]
team = pelox
access_code = ac_a38ab2
owner = tamion.julael
host = framir.tolvaqlabs.test
port = 11211
peer = tammir.zemvargrid.local
salt = 2215ef03
pin = 1541

## Thumbler Service — Environments

Thumbler handles thumbnail generation for uploads across the Pellwick platform. Jobs land on a per-environment queue; workers poll, render, and write results to the asset store. Staging runs a single worker with aggressive retry limits so failures surface quickly during review, while production runs a larger pool with longer visibility timeouts. When reviewing changes, confirm that queue names and concurrency settings match the intended environment. The production queue configuration is as follows.

settings of fafog-haduf:
ZORIX_PIN=4648
ZORIX_METRICS_HOST=metrics.zorix.paliqsys.corp
ZORIX_LOG_LEVEL=info
ZORIX_TENANT=druix

Licensing Dispute — Varnhelm Toolkit (managers only)

Status: Ongoing. Quellis Systems alleges our use of the Varnhelm rendering module exceeds the agreed seat count. Legal is negotiating; department heads should pause new deployments and log current usage. No external comment. Our position and fallback options are outlined in the note below.

board note of fahif-yahog: Gross margin on Wenath came in at 10 percent against a plan of 5 percent. Only 3 of the 100 pilot accounts renewed Wenath, so a churn review is set for July 15.

## Service Accounts — Planner Regression

Queryforge planner regressed after the v41 stats change; join reordering now picks nested loops on the Orvane fact tables. Mitigation: pin the planner hint via the svc-planner account until the fix ships. Only the shared eng-sync service account may set hints in staging. Its key follows below.

service key, bajep-hahig: zpat15_8GdlyV2kd9BCqYH